notbugAs an Amazon Associate I earn from qualifying purchases.
Want a good read? Try FreeBSD Mastery: Jails (IT Mastery Book 15)
Want a good monitor light? See my photosAll times are UTC
Ukraine
Port details
rizin-cutter Free and Open Source Reverse Engineering Platform
2.3.4 lang on this many watch lists=2 search for ports that depend on this port Find issues related to this port Report an issue related to this port View this port on Repology. pkg-fallout 2.3.4Version of this port present on the latest quarterly branch.
Maintainer: arrowd@FreeBSD.org search for ports maintained by this maintainer
Port Added: 2024-03-30 18:30:07
Last Update: 2024-03-30 18:26:24
Commit Hash: 6ed1bd4
People watching this port, also watch:: jdictionary, py311-Automat, py311-python-gdsii, py39-PyOpenGL, p5-Sane
Also Listed In: devel
License: GPLv3
WWW:
https://cutter.re/
Description:
Cutter is a free and open-source reverse engineering platform powered by Rizin. It aims at being an advanced and customizable reverse engineering platform while keeping the user experience in mind.
Homepage    cgit ¦ Codeberg ¦ GitHub ¦ GitLab ¦ SVNWeb - no subversion history for this port

Manual pages:
FreshPorts has no man page information for this port.
pkg-plist: as obtained via: make generate-plist
Expand this list (197 items)
Collapse this list.
  1. /usr/local/share/licenses/rizin-cutter-2.3.4/catalog.mk
  2. /usr/local/share/licenses/rizin-cutter-2.3.4/LICENSE
  3. /usr/local/share/licenses/rizin-cutter-2.3.4/GPLv3
  4. bin/cutter
  5. include/cutter/CutterApplication.h
  6. include/cutter/common/AddressableItemModel.h
  7. include/cutter/common/AnalysisTask.h
  8. include/cutter/common/AsyncTask.h
  9. include/cutter/common/BasicBlockHighlighter.h
  10. include/cutter/common/BasicInstructionHighlighter.h
  11. include/cutter/common/BinaryTrees.h
  12. include/cutter/common/BugReporting.h
  13. include/cutter/common/CachedFontMetrics.h
  14. include/cutter/common/ColorThemeWorker.h
  15. include/cutter/common/Colors.h
  16. include/cutter/common/CommandTask.h
  17. include/cutter/common/Configuration.h
  18. include/cutter/common/CutterLayout.h
  19. include/cutter/common/CutterSeekable.h
  20. include/cutter/common/Decompiler.h
  21. include/cutter/common/DecompilerHighlighter.h
  22. include/cutter/common/DirectionalComboBox.h
  23. include/cutter/common/FunctionsTask.h
  24. include/cutter/common/Helpers.h
  25. include/cutter/common/HighDpiPixmap.h
  26. include/cutter/common/Highlighter.h
  27. include/cutter/common/IOModesController.h
  28. include/cutter/common/InitialOptions.h
  29. include/cutter/common/Json.h
  30. include/cutter/common/JsonModel.h
  31. include/cutter/common/LinkedListPool.h
  32. include/cutter/common/MdHighlighter.h
  33. include/cutter/common/ProgressIndicator.h
  34. include/cutter/common/RefreshDeferrer.h
  35. include/cutter/common/ResourcePaths.h
  36. include/cutter/common/RichTextPainter.h
  37. include/cutter/common/RizinTask.h
  38. include/cutter/common/RunScriptTask.h
  39. include/cutter/common/SelectionHighlight.h
  40. include/cutter/common/SettingsUpgrade.h
  41. include/cutter/common/StringsTask.h
  42. include/cutter/common/SvgIconEngine.h
  43. include/cutter/common/SyntaxHighlighter.h
  44. include/cutter/common/TempConfig.h
  45. include/cutter/common/UpdateWorker.h
  46. include/cutter/core/Basefind.h
  47. include/cutter/core/Cutter.h
  48. include/cutter/core/CutterCommon.h
  49. include/cutter/core/CutterDescriptions.h
  50. include/cutter/core/CutterJson.h
  51. include/cutter/core/MainWindow.h
  52. include/cutter/core/RizinCpp.h
  53. include/cutter/dialogs/AboutDialog.h
  54. include/cutter/dialogs/ArenaInfoDialog.h
  55. include/cutter/dialogs/AsyncTaskDialog.h
  56. include/cutter/dialogs/AttachProcDialog.h
  57. include/cutter/dialogs/BreakpointsDialog.h
  58. include/cutter/dialogs/CommentsDialog.h
  59. include/cutter/dialogs/EditFunctionDialog.h
  60. include/cutter/dialogs/EditInstructionDialog.h
  61. include/cutter/dialogs/EditMethodDialog.h
  62. include/cutter/dialogs/EditStringDialog.h
  63. include/cutter/dialogs/EditVariablesDialog.h
  64. include/cutter/dialogs/FlagDialog.h
  65. include/cutter/dialogs/GlibcHeapBinsDialog.h
  66. include/cutter/dialogs/GlibcHeapInfoDialog.h
  67. include/cutter/dialogs/GlobalVariableDialog.h
  68. include/cutter/dialogs/HexdumpRangeDialog.h
  69. include/cutter/dialogs/InitialOptionsDialog.h
  70. include/cutter/dialogs/LayoutManager.h
  71. include/cutter/dialogs/MapFileDialog.h
  72. include/cutter/dialogs/MultitypeFileSaveDialog.h
  73. include/cutter/dialogs/NativeDebugDialog.h
  74. include/cutter/dialogs/NewFileDialog.h
  75. include/cutter/dialogs/RemoteDebugDialog.h
  76. include/cutter/dialogs/RizinPluginsDialog.h
  77. include/cutter/dialogs/RizinTaskDialog.h
  78. include/cutter/dialogs/SetToDataDialog.h
  79. include/cutter/dialogs/TypesInteractionDialog.h
  80. include/cutter/dialogs/VersionInfoDialog.h
  81. include/cutter/dialogs/WelcomeDialog.h
  82. include/cutter/dialogs/WriteCommandsDialogs.h
  83. include/cutter/dialogs/XrefsDialog.h
  84. include/cutter/dialogs/preferences/AnalysisOptionsWidget.h
  85. include/cutter/dialogs/preferences/AppearanceOptionsWidget.h
  86. include/cutter/dialogs/preferences/AsmOptionsWidget.h
  87. include/cutter/dialogs/preferences/ColorThemeEditDialog.h
  88. include/cutter/dialogs/preferences/DebugOptionsWidget.h
  89. include/cutter/dialogs/preferences/GraphOptionsWidget.h
  90. include/cutter/dialogs/preferences/InitializationFileEditor.h
  91. include/cutter/dialogs/preferences/PluginsOptionsWidget.h
  92. include/cutter/dialogs/preferences/PreferenceCategory.h
  93. include/cutter/dialogs/preferences/PreferencesDialog.h
  94. include/cutter/menus/AddressableItemContextMenu.h
  95. include/cutter/menus/DecompilerContextMenu.h
  96. include/cutter/menus/DisassemblyContextMenu.h
  97. include/cutter/menus/FlirtContextMenu.h
  98. include/cutter/plugins/CutterPlugin.h
  99. include/cutter/plugins/PluginManager.h
  100. include/cutter/tools/basefind/BaseFindDialog.h
  101. include/cutter/tools/basefind/BaseFindResultsDialog.h
  102. include/cutter/tools/basefind/BaseFindSearchDialog.h
  103. include/cutter/widgets/AddressableDockWidget.h
  104. include/cutter/widgets/AddressableItemList.h
  105. include/cutter/widgets/BacktraceWidget.h
  106. include/cutter/widgets/BoolToggleDelegate.h
  107. include/cutter/widgets/BreakpointWidget.h
  108. include/cutter/widgets/CallGraph.h
  109. include/cutter/widgets/ClassesWidget.h
  110. include/cutter/widgets/ColorPicker.h
  111. include/cutter/widgets/ColorThemeComboBox.h
  112. include/cutter/widgets/ColorThemeListView.h
  113. include/cutter/widgets/ComboQuickFilterView.h
  114. include/cutter/widgets/CommentsWidget.h
  115. include/cutter/widgets/ConsoleWidget.h
  116. include/cutter/widgets/CutterDockWidget.h
  117. include/cutter/widgets/CutterGraphView.h
  118. include/cutter/widgets/CutterTreeView.h
  119. include/cutter/widgets/CutterTreeWidget.h
  120. include/cutter/widgets/Dashboard.h
  121. include/cutter/widgets/DebugActions.h
  122. include/cutter/widgets/DecompilerWidget.h
  123. include/cutter/widgets/DisassemblerGraphView.h
  124. include/cutter/widgets/DisassemblyWidget.h
  125. include/cutter/widgets/EntrypointWidget.h
  126. include/cutter/widgets/ExportsWidget.h
  127. include/cutter/widgets/FlagsWidget.h
  128. include/cutter/widgets/FlirtWidget.h
  129. include/cutter/widgets/FunctionsWidget.h
  130. include/cutter/widgets/GlibcHeapWidget.h
  131. include/cutter/widgets/GraphGridLayout.h
  132. include/cutter/widgets/GraphHorizontalAdapter.h
  133. include/cutter/widgets/GraphLayout.h
  134. include/cutter/widgets/GraphView.h
  135. include/cutter/widgets/GraphWidget.h
  136. include/cutter/widgets/GraphvizLayout.h
  137. include/cutter/widgets/HeadersWidget.h
  138. include/cutter/widgets/HeapBinsGraphView.h
  139. include/cutter/widgets/HeapDockWidget.h
  140. include/cutter/widgets/HexWidget.h
  141. include/cutter/widgets/HexdumpWidget.h
  142. include/cutter/widgets/ImportsWidget.h
  143. include/cutter/widgets/ListDockWidget.h
  144. include/cutter/widgets/MemoryDockWidget.h
  145. include/cutter/widgets/MemoryMapWidget.h
  146. include/cutter/widgets/Omnibar.h
  147. include/cutter/widgets/OverviewView.h
  148. include/cutter/widgets/OverviewWidget.h
  149. include/cutter/widgets/ProcessesWidget.h
  150. include/cutter/widgets/QuickFilterView.h
  151. include/cutter/widgets/RegisterRefsWidget.h
  152. include/cutter/widgets/RegistersWidget.h
  153. include/cutter/widgets/RelocsWidget.h
  154. include/cutter/widgets/ResourcesWidget.h
  155. include/cutter/widgets/RizinGraphWidget.h
  156. include/cutter/widgets/SdbWidget.h
  157. include/cutter/widgets/SearchWidget.h
  158. include/cutter/widgets/SectionsWidget.h
  159. include/cutter/widgets/SegmentsWidget.h
  160. include/cutter/widgets/SimpleTextGraphView.h
  161. include/cutter/widgets/StackWidget.h
  162. include/cutter/widgets/StringsWidget.h
  163. include/cutter/widgets/SymbolsWidget.h
  164. include/cutter/widgets/ThreadsWidget.h
  165. include/cutter/widgets/TypesWidget.h
  166. include/cutter/widgets/VTablesWidget.h
  167. include/cutter/widgets/VisualNavbar.h
  168. lib/cmake/Cutter/CutterConfig.cmake
  169. lib/cmake/Cutter/CutterConfigVersion.cmake
  170. lib/cmake/Cutter/CutterTargets-release.cmake
  171. lib/cmake/Cutter/CutterTargets.cmake
  172. share/applications/re.rizin.cutter.desktop
  173. share/icons/hicolor/scalable/apps/cutter.svg
  174. share/rizin/cutter/translations/cutter_ar.qm
  175. share/rizin/cutter/translations/cutter_bn.qm
  176. share/rizin/cutter/translations/cutter_ca.qm
  177. share/rizin/cutter/translations/cutter_de.qm
  178. share/rizin/cutter/translations/cutter_es.qm
  179. share/rizin/cutter/translations/cutter_fa.qm
  180. share/rizin/cutter/translations/cutter_fr.qm
  181. share/rizin/cutter/translations/cutter_he.qm
  182. share/rizin/cutter/translations/cutter_hi.qm
  183. share/rizin/cutter/translations/cutter_it.qm
  184. share/rizin/cutter/translations/cutter_ja.qm
  185. share/rizin/cutter/translations/cutter_ko.qm
  186. share/rizin/cutter/translations/cutter_nl.qm
  187. share/rizin/cutter/translations/cutter_pt.qm
  188. share/rizin/cutter/translations/cutter_ro.qm
  189. share/rizin/cutter/translations/cutter_ru.qm
  190. share/rizin/cutter/translations/cutter_tr.qm
  191. share/rizin/cutter/translations/cutter_uk.qm
  192. share/rizin/cutter/translations/cutter_ur.qm
  193. share/rizin/cutter/translations/cutter_vi.qm
  194. share/rizin/cutter/translations/cutter_zh.qm
  195. @owner
  196. @group
  197. @mode
Collapse this list.
Dependency lines:
  • rizin-cutter>0:lang/rizin-cutter
To install the port:
cd /usr/ports/lang/rizin-cutter/ && make install clean
To add the package, run one of these commands:
  • pkg install lang/rizin-cutter
  • pkg install rizin-cutter
NOTE: If this package has multiple flavors (see below), then use one of them instead of the name specified above.
PKGNAME: rizin-cutter
Flavors: there is no flavor information for this port.
distinfo:
TIMESTAMP = 1711647661 SHA256 (rizinorg-cutter-v2.3.4_GH0.tar.gz) = 5dc07d6a4903ccdb6c031310a85377793edf24dc0b8990e70a8f5c94af06a2a2 SIZE (rizinorg-cutter-v2.3.4_GH0.tar.gz) = 2699925

Expand this list (2 items)

Collapse this list.

SHA256 (rizinorg-cutter-translations-8358f17_GH0.tar.gz) = 31aecb9d85a4fa324f0c98e436bba5339341e526b4b18ae3def4a2befa9991fd SIZE (rizinorg-cutter-translations-8358f17_GH0.tar.gz) = 1106205

Collapse this list.


Packages (timestamps in pop-ups are UTC):
rizin-cutter
ABIaarch64amd64armv6armv7i386powerpcpowerpc64powerpc64le
FreeBSD:13:latest2.3.42.3.4--2.3.4---
FreeBSD:13:quarterly2.3.42.3.4--2.3.4---
FreeBSD:14:latest2.3.42.3.4--2.3.4---
FreeBSD:14:quarterly2.3.42.3.4--2.3.4---
FreeBSD:15:latest2.3.42.3.4n/a-n/a---
Dependencies
NOTE: FreshPorts displays only information on required and default dependencies. Optional dependencies are not covered.
Build dependencies:
  1. py39-pyaml>=23.5.9 : textproc/py-pyaml@py39
  2. cmake : devel/cmake-core
  3. ninja : devel/ninja
  4. update-desktop-database : devel/desktop-file-utils
  5. pkgconf>=1.3.0_1 : devel/pkgconf
  6. lupdate : devel/qt6-tools
Runtime dependencies:
  1. update-desktop-database : devel/desktop-file-utils
  2. lupdate : devel/qt6-tools
Library dependencies:
  1. librz_core.so : lang/rizin
  2. libgvc.so : graphics/graphviz
  3. libQt6Core5Compat.so : devel/qt6-5compat
  4. libQt6Core.so : devel/qt6-base
  5. libQt6Svg.so : graphics/qt6-svg
There are no ports dependent upon this port

Configuration Options:
No options to configure
Options name:
lang_rizin-cutter
USES:
cmake desktop-file-utils pkgconfig python:env qt:6
FreshPorts was unable to extract/find any pkg message
Master Sites:
Expand this list (1 items)
Collapse this list.
  1. https://codeload.github.com/rizinorg/cutter/tar.gz/v2.3.4?dummy=/
Collapse this list.

Number of commits found: 1

Commit History - (may be incomplete: for full details, see links to repositories near top of page)
CommitCreditsLog message
2.3.4
30 Mar 2024 18:26:24
commit hash: 6ed1bd442abdc56a68b1eeebbb0b0a73ebb4bd08commit hash: 6ed1bd442abdc56a68b1eeebbb0b0a73ebb4bd08commit hash: 6ed1bd442abdc56a68b1eeebbb0b0a73ebb4bd08commit hash: 6ed1bd442abdc56a68b1eeebbb0b0a73ebb4bd08 files touched by this commit
Gleb Popov (arrowd) search for other commits by this committer
Author: Er2
lang/rizin-cutter: Reverse engineering platform powered by Rizin

Number of commits found: 1